ARM: adding genMachineCheckFault() stub for ARM that doesn't panic
This commit is contained in:
parent
5486fa6612
commit
7acf67971c
1 changed files with 5 additions and 0 deletions
|
@ -49,6 +49,7 @@
|
||||||
#include "arch/arm/types.hh"
|
#include "arch/arm/types.hh"
|
||||||
#include "config/full_system.hh"
|
#include "config/full_system.hh"
|
||||||
#include "sim/faults.hh"
|
#include "sim/faults.hh"
|
||||||
|
#include "base/misc.hh"
|
||||||
|
|
||||||
// The design of the "name" and "vect" functions is in sim/faults.hh
|
// The design of the "name" and "vect" functions is in sim/faults.hh
|
||||||
|
|
||||||
|
@ -217,6 +218,10 @@ class DataAbort : public AbortFault<DataAbort>
|
||||||
class Interrupt : public ArmFaultVals<Interrupt> {};
|
class Interrupt : public ArmFaultVals<Interrupt> {};
|
||||||
class FastInterrupt : public ArmFaultVals<FastInterrupt> {};
|
class FastInterrupt : public ArmFaultVals<FastInterrupt> {};
|
||||||
|
|
||||||
|
static inline Fault genMachineCheckFault()
|
||||||
|
{
|
||||||
|
return new Reset();
|
||||||
|
}
|
||||||
|
|
||||||
} // ArmISA namespace
|
} // ArmISA namespace
|
||||||
|
|
||||||
|
|
Loading…
Reference in a new issue